Plants perform photosynthesis in chloroplasts, where light energy is converted into chemical energy by a series of electrochemical reactions. In contrast, land plants are exposed incessantly to excess light energy or harsh atmospheric environments that engender \u2018photodamage\u2019. How do plants cope with such photosynthetic inactivation? What are the key elements to maintaining or even maximizing chloroplast functions? Our group studies various aspects of chloroplast development and photosynthesis. This chloroplastic redox state directly impacts electron transport in photosynthesis and is crucial in efficient photosynthetic reactions. We have identified novel proteins that regulate the redox state in the chloroplasts and are investigating how plants adapt to fluctuating light environments.<\/p>\n<p>&nbsp;<\/p>\n","protected":false},"excerpt":{"rendered":"<p>Plant Genetics and Physiology Our life on earth cannot continue without the atmospheric environment, which is  [&hellip;]<\/p>\n","protected":false},"author":5,"featured_media":0,"parent":150,"menu_order":192,"comment_status":"closed","ping_status":"closed","template":"","meta":{"footnotes":""},"class_list":["post-468","page","type-page","status-publish","hentry"],"aioseo_notices":[],"aioseo_head":"\n\t\t<!-- All in One SEO 4.9.10 -
